d5 Samsung washing machine error code

The d5 error code on a Samsung washing machine also indicates a door issue, similar to the dS error code. It specifically signifies a door not open error. This means the machine detects that the door is open when it shouldn't be, preventing it from starting a cycle or continuing if it was already running.

Here's what you can do about the d5 error

Possible causes:

  • Accidental door opening: 
    • Someone might have inadvertently opened the door during the cycle.
  • Faulty door switch: 
    • The switch responsible for detecting the door's position could be malfunctioning and sending incorrect signals.
  • Internal wiring issues: 
    • In rare cases, loose or damaged wiring related to the door switch might be causing the error.

Troubleshooting the d5 Error Codes on Samsung Washing Machine

  1. Verify the door is closed: 
    • Double-check that the door is firmly shut and latched properly. There shouldn't be any gap or movement in the door.
  2. Restart the cycle: 
    • Once the door is confirmed closed, try restarting the washing cycle. This might resolve the issue if it was a momentary glitch.
  3. Consult your user manual: 
    • Your manual might have specific instructions for troubleshooting the d5 error code for your particular model. This could include resetting the door switch or other relevant procedures.
  4. Contact Samsung support: 
    • If the above steps don't resolve the issue, contact Samsung support for further assistance or technician recommendations. They can help diagnose the problem based on your model and provide specific guidance, potentially suggesting checking the door switch or internal wiring if necessary.

Additional tips:

  • Avoid opening the door during the wash cycle unless absolutely necessary.
  • Don't attempt to tamper with the door switch or wiring yourself unless you have the necessary expertise. Doing so could worsen the problem or create safety hazards.
  • Consider child safety locks on the washing machine's control panel to prevent accidental door opening, especially if you have young children in the house.

Remember, the exact cause and troubleshooting steps might vary depending on your specific Samsung washing machine model. Consulting your user manual or contacting Samsung support can provide the most accurate information and guidance for your situation.
